渣渣的第一篇博文,希望能帮到别人 。
实验室有内网环境,不能连接外网,但是实验需要用到word2vec,没办法,只能尝试离线安装gensim。因为内网我安装过Anaconda3,所以numpy,sccipy等库都已经安装好了,Python版本是python 3.5.2。下面就是离线安装gensim的详细步骤:
步骤1. 下载gensim-3.4.0.tar.gz。
解压,cmd窗口进到所在文件夹,编译:python setup.py build,安装:python setup.py install;
步骤2. 缺包smart_open,下载smart_open-1.5.7.tar.gz,解压,编译,安装;
步骤3. 缺包boto3,下载boto3-1.7.16.tar.gz,解压,编译,安装;
步骤4. 缺包s3transfer,下载s3transfer-0.1.10.tar.gz,解压,编译,安装;
步骤5. 缺包botocore ,下载botocore-1.3.0.tar.gz,解压,编译,安装;
步骤6. 缺包jmespath ,下载 jmespath-0.7.1.tar.gz,解压,编译,安装;
步骤7. 回退安装:botocore、s3transfer;
步骤8. 缺包botocore,下载botocore-1.10.16.tar.gz,解压,编译,安装;
步骤9. 回退安装s3transfer、boto、smart_open;
步骤10. 缺包bz2file,下载bz2file-0.98.tar.gz,解压,编译,安装;
步骤11. 回退安装smart_open;